Seller: Books & Bidders, Cleveland, OH, U.S.A.
Cloth. Condition: Near Fine. Dust Jacket Condition: Very Good. First Edition. Original quarter cloth over patterned boards in unclipped ($3.50) mylar protected dust-jacket, paper spine label, top edge dark red-brown, (9.5 x 6 inches). First Edition/First Edition with title page printed in black and brick red, with colophon. Only 2240 copies printed, edited by Edmund Wilson with 8 of Fitzgerald's later autobiographical pieces and 149 pages of notes, plus letters to Fitzgerald from Gertrude Stein, Edith Wharton, T.S. Eliot, Thomas Wolfe, and John Dos Passos. Essays and Poems by Paul Rosenfeld, Glenway Wescott, John Dos Passos, John Peale Bishop, and Edmund Wilson. Slight sunning to jacket spine, and quarter inch chip at the head of dust jacket spine as well as some minor chipping to heel and edges. Size: Octavo. Seller Inventory # 005061
